Call for Paper - January 2019 Edition
IJCA solicits original research papers for the January 2019 Edition. Last date of manuscript submission is December 20, 2018. Read More

An Effective Model of Effort Estimation for Cleanroom Software Development Approach

IJCA Proceedings on International Conference on Recent Developments in Science, Technology, Humanities and Management
© 2018 by IJCA Journal
ICRDSTHM 2017 - Number 1
Year of Publication: 2018
Manan Jindal
Komal Munjal
Anurag Jain
Hitesh Kumar Sharma


The integration of mathematical modelling, proof of correctness and statistical software quality assurance lead to extremely high-quality software. The integration was named as cleanroom software engineering. It proofs the correctness of the deliverables of each phase, instead of the classic analysis, design, code, test, and debug cycle, the cleanroom approach suggests a different point of view. Due to the evolution in development methodology there is a strong need of evolution in estimation models also. In this work, proposed the new cost estimation model. The evolved model is proposed for the new development methodologies and includes some more factors for estimation used in these new approaches.


  • M. Dyer, 1992. The Cleanroom Approach to Quality Software Development, Wiley.
  • H. D. Mills, M. Dyer and R. Linger, 1987. Cleanroom Software Engineering, IEEE Software, pp. 19–25.
  • M. Dyer, 1987. An Approach to Software Reliability Measurement, Information and Software Technology, Volume 29, Issue 8.
  • G. E. Head, 1994. Six-Sigma Software Using Cleanroom Software Engineering Techniques, Hewlett-Packard Journal, pp. 40–50.
  • R. Oshana, 1996. Quality Software via a Cleanroom Methodology, Embedded Systems Programming, pp. 36–52.
  • B. Boehm, 2000. Software Cost Estimation in COCOMO II, Prentice-Hall.
  • C. Jones, 1996. How Software Estimation Tools Work, American Programmer, Volume 9, Issue 7, pp. 19–27.
  • J. Matson, B. Barrett, J. Mellichamp, 1994. Software Development Cost Estimation Using Function Points, IEEE Trans. Software Engineering, Volume SE-20, Issue 4, pp. 275–287.
  • D. Minoli, 1995. Analyzing Outsourcing, Mc Graw-Hill.
  • D. Phillips, 1998. The Software Project Manager's Handbook, IEEE Computer Society Press.